In the Salt Lake School District, two students have been suspended so far this school year for weapons violations.

As in the Jordan District, those students will be able to appeal their suspensions.

In both the Jordan and Salt Lake districts, suspension does not automatically mean the child does not go to school for a year. In most cases, the districts attempt to provide alternative schooling for those students, whether it is at another school, in a classroom by themselves or at the student's home.

The law is clear for students who bring a real gun to school, said Shannon Andersen, supervisor of Counselor and Student Services in the Salt Lake district. But the district is currently rewriting its penalties concerning gun facsimiles.

A student's potential suspension for bringing a toy gun to school will "depend on the type of facsimile and how it was used," she said.
